  1. Rien is a 1994 album by the German krautrock group Faust. It was their fifth album, and their first reunion album. The album was produced by Jim O'Rourke.

    18 de jun. de 2009 · With Rien, Faust, the German avant-rock legend of the 70s whose savage electroacoustic forays helped sharpen Euro-rocks cutting edge and paved the way for post-punk experimentalists, 80s Industrialists and 90s Ambient artists around the globe, have rediscovered the mystique that was an essential part of their creative being; a Dadaist bent that manifested itself in both performance and ...

With Faust now being back in action after their 1994 release of Rien, the stage was set for more avant-garde rock affairs. 1997 was a particularly big time to be a Faust fan, as that year they released two studio albums and a live album, something you might not fully expect from a legacy group like Faust.
